• Publicidad

Fecha actual 2025-04-28 21:17 @929

News News of Mundo Perl

Site map of Mundo Perl » Foro : Mundo Perl

Módulo PDF

Hola,

Como verás estoy muy pez en esto de Perl.
Me gustaría usar el módulo PDF::Report pero me da error (Can't locate PDF/Report.pm in @INC). Lo he buscado pero no lo encuentro. Tampoco encuentro el programa ppm.exe ¿Cómo puedo instalarlo?

Muchas gracias.
Read more : Módulo PDF | Vistas : 874 | Respuestas : 1 | Foro : Intermedio


Problemas con columnas

Hola. En una ocasión anterior me ayudaron a descargar archivos HTML y transformarlos a .txt, acá está el script:

#!/usr/bin/perl

use strict;
use LWP::Simple;
$|++;

my $URL = 'http://weather.uwyo.edu/cgi-bin/sounding?region=samer&TYPE=TEXT%3ALIST&YEAR=2005';
my $url = '&STNM=85442';

foreach my $mes ( "04" ) {
foreach my $dia ( "01" .. "09" ) {
foreach my $hora ( 12 ) {

my $fecha = "$dia-$mes-$hora";
my $fichero = "$fecha.dat";
my $pagina = get("$URL&MONTH=$mes&FROM=$dia$hora&TO=$dia$hora$url");

if (defined $pagina) {
if ((my $datos) ...
Read more : Problemas con columnas | Vistas : 1321 | Respuestas : 4 | Foro : Básico


Problemas con funciones seno y coseno

Hola amigos del foro: Hice un script y no me funciona y según yo está bien pero aún no veo dónde está el error para que me funcione, a ver si me ayudan.

Tengo una carpeta que se llama Abril y dentro de ésta tengo 30 archivos con extensión .dat que, a modo de ejemplo, uno de estos archivos contiene lo siguiente:

1001.0 137 13.2 9.1 76 7.29 170 3 286.3 306.8 287.5
1000.0 125 ...
Read more : Problemas con funciones seno y coseno | Vistas : 1477 | Respuestas : 4 | Foro : Básico


El preámbulo ./

Hola, estoy tratando de buscar quée hace el comando ./
Me pasaron un código para ejecutar un programa en Perl y no logro hacerlo andar.
Estoy usando Windows Vista, por lo cual para ejecutar el comando, abro un command executer en DOS.
Allí, entro al directorio en donde tengo grabado el programita que me pasaron y supuestamente poniendo ./run_trees data/letter deberían ejecutarse todos los comandos. El problema es que no le gusta el .
¿Alguno ...
Read more : El preámbulo ./ | Vistas : 2637 | Respuestas : 22 | Foro : Básico


Sort con 'ñ'

Hola otra vez,

Tengo un problema con la ñ. Trabajo en UTF8 y al hacer un sort ordena mal la ñ ¿Alguien sabe cómo puedo solucionarlo?

Muchas gracias
Read more : Sort con 'ñ' | Vistas : 1235 | Respuestas : 1 | Foro : Intermedio


Problema con print en un loop

Pues nunca pensé que iba a tener problemas con el print() :oops:

#!/usr/bin/perl -w
use strict;

my $numeros = 4;
for my $numero ( 1 .. $numeros ) {
print "hola $numero";
sleep(1);
}

Resulta que no se va imprimiendo a medida que avanza el loop, se imprime todo de golpe al finalizar el loop.

Por el contrario si le añado un salto de línea \n , ...
Read more : Problema con print en un loop | Vistas : 704 | Respuestas : 2 | Foro : Básico


Optimizar al compilar

Buenos días. Estuve probando la compilación con pp en Linux, pero resulta que al compilar me deja con el tamaño que menos imaginaba.

#!/usr/bin/perl

use LWP::Simple;

my $pagina = get('http://www.google.com/');

print $pagina;

<STDIN>;

El archivo google.pl pesa 112 bytes. Al compilar comprobé que ya pesaba 4.4MB ... jojojo...

Me sorprendí. Pregunto si no hay forma de reducirlo, o quizás esto es normal en Perl. Es porque en otros lenguajes no es así si no me ...
Read more : Optimizar al compilar | Vistas : 2000 | Respuestas : 10 | Foro : Intermedio


Problemas con Math:::MatrixReal y Math::FixedPrecision

Hola a todos

He instalado 2 módulos: Math::MatrixReal y Math::FixedPrecision, ambas instaladas por "perl -MCPAN -eshell" y luego "install Math::MatrixReal" e "instal Math::FixedPrecision", al parecer sin ningún error. Cuando intento correr un programa como este
#!/usr/bin/perl
use Math::FixedPrecision;

me da el siguiente error:
Code: Seleccionar todo
Can't locate Math/FixedPrecision.pm in @INC (@INC contains: /usr/lib/perl5/5.10.0/i586-linux-thread-multi /usr/lib/perl5/5.10.0 /usr/lib/perl5/site_perl/5.10.0/i586-linux-thread-multi /usr/lib/perl5/site_perl/5.10.0 /usr/lib/perl5/vendor_perl/5.10.0/i586-linux-thread-multi /usr/lib/perl5/vendor_perl/5.10.0 /usr/lib/perl5/vendor_perl .) at ./presicion.pl line 2.
BEGIN failed--compilation aborted at ./presicion.pl line 2.


Prácticamente me da el mismo error ...
Read more : Problemas con Math:::MatrixReal y Math::FixedPrecision | Vistas : 2100 | Respuestas : 7 | Foro : Módulos


Win32::MsgBox

Hola

Programo en Perl 5 (revisión 5 versión 8 subversión 8) sobre una plataforma WinXP y estoy en busca de una forma de interacción gráfica con el usuario para unos reportes que requieren filtros personalizados, encontré la sentencia Win32::MsgBox, pero solo me da la opción de manejar botones sin tener la posibilidad del ingreso de datos como fechas y otras cosas que necesito de parámetros.

¿Conoce alguien alguna herramienta o tiene algún ejemplo para poder ...
Read more : Win32::MsgBox | Vistas : 1384 | Respuestas : 2 | Foro : Módulos


Llamado desde cgi

Hola, ¿qué tal?, mi pregunta creo que es muy sencilla para ustedes pero un poco crítica para mí.
Tengo unos programas en Perl que ejecutan comandos de otra herramienta como el siguiente.

$envia_tarea = system ("wruntask -t tk-typecold -l Tareas_Framework -p pm-adicionalGB -d TIVOLI -f d:/cold/$salida/salida.log");

Quiero pasar mi programa a CGI pero intento correr un comando aun más simple que el anterior y no genera nada de lo que necesito. Algo como esto:

#!D:\perl\bin\perl.exe ...
Read more : Llamado desde cgi | Vistas : 808 | Respuestas : 3 | Foro : Básico


 

Identificarte  •  Registrarse


Estadísticas

Mensajes totales 36892 • Temas totales 7434 • Usuarios totales 1981